By Paul Gertner…  One of the hottest shows this summer has been Penn & Teller: Fool US, which is now in its third season on the CW Network. I had the pleasure of appearing on the show this season. I was assigned the task of fooling Penn & Teller…with a trick they already knew.

If you have not had a chance to view my recent appearance on Fool Us, you can go to my YouTube page and click on the Penn & Teller Video Link to watch that performance video before reading any further. If you do, this Blog Post will make a lot more sense. You can also link to the video from my website.

Back in February I was contacted by Lee Terbosic an excellent magician and good friend from Pittsburgh who said he had an opportunity to appear on the TV show Penn & Teller Fool Us. But the tricky part (pun intended) was that they wanted him to perform my routine Unshuffled and he was contacting me to get my permission to perform that routine on the show. (As a side note to magicians reading this: That was a very professional thing to do. Unshuffled is a published routine and Lee was under no obligation to do that, but he’s a pro.)

I have to admit, I was a bit surprised that Fool Us wanted someone else to do my trick because to me that show is all about original inventions… or at least magicians adding their own unique presentation to a trick and seeing if their performance was clever enough to fool the Bad Boys of Magic: Penn & Teller. Couples who dream of a “fairy-tale” wedding in front of the iconic Cinderella Castle at Disney World’s Magic Kingdom can now have all their dreams come true … without the worries of turning into a pumpkin at midnight.

Disney recently announced a new “Magic Kingdom Park After-Hours” wedding package at its Walt Disney World Resort in Orlando, Florida.

The package includes an exclusive evening ceremony and reception in front of Cinderella Castle for up to 300 guests, with the chance to ride in Cinderella’s Coach down Magic Kingdom’s “Main Street, U.S.A.” and the opportunity to experience Magic Kingdom park without the crowds.

HelloGiggles, a women’s online community, lists the package at $180,000 for the bare minimum of amenities. That’s not including the ride in Cinderella’s Coach.
